I was just pointing out what other people in the community seem to be saying, but my personal opinion is that Wuwa writers seem to do their best when they create character stories, not world stories. For example the Encore, Cartethyia, and Phrolova stories are all highly regarded among the player base, and I personally really enjoyed Chisa's story as well.

However, whatever they did in 2.0 was not it. They were trying to tell a story about the world, but tried to focus on a single character without making it into a full-on character story. This ended up diluting a lot of Lynae's and Mornye's backstory and their interactions with Rover as they were trying to fit everything in a small time-budget. I think the writers should choose to either focus on the world and put in a companion story, or focus on the character and put in more world quests. (For smaller regions like Honami and the Fabricatorium a world quest is optional, but for a large update like 2.0 ppl would probably expect more)

Another thing I would argue is that part of what made Phrolova's story so impactful was that she appeared so many times before her story, so Rover already knew her, players were curious about her, and the writers didn't need to spend time introducing her. Same with Jinhsi and Cartethyia (as well as every companion quest). This is why I think Kuro should do this with every character: have them make an appearance before their main patch so we at least know what type of person they're like.

Character interactions was something the community talked about a few months ago and has since died down. The main discussion now is just not solely focusing on the on-banner character in the story. That involves having more characters appear before they become playable and stay in the story longer after they go off banner. This is different than wanting characters to interact with each other. People just want characters to be relevant for more than a patch.

The second part of the discussion is bringing back companion stories. This stems from the previous part, because the ppl think the current banner character is taking too much screen time off of other characters, so a solution is to move that screen time to companion quests so both sides - the current character and the whole cast - wins.

Neither of these things need to happen at the expense of putting in more interactions. When you have multiple characters in a story you can still just have them all only interact with the MC and not with each other
